How do you prove geometry?

The most common way to construct a geometry proof is to use a two column proof. Write a statement on one side and a reason on the other. Every claim must have a reason to prove its truth. The reasons include that there were definitions, postulates and theorems of a problem or geometry.

What does it mean to proof in geometry?

A geometric proof, like any mathematical proof, is an argument that begins with known facts, proceeds from them through a series of logical inferences, and ends with what it tries to prove.

:brown_circle: What is geometry statement?

A conditional statement is an "if-then" statement used in geometry to relate a particular hypothesis to the conclusion. An arrow leading from a hypothesis, denoted by p, and pointing to a conclusion, denoted by q, represents a conditional statement.

:brown_circle: What is proof in math?

In mathematics, a proof is a justification of a mathematical statement. In reasoning, other previously established statements can be used, such as theorems. In principle, the proof can be traced back to obvious or assumed statements, the so-called axioms, but also to generally accepted rules of inference.

What is a two-column geometric proof?

A two-column geometric proof consists of a list of statements and reasons why you know those statements are true. The left column lists the claims and the right column lists the reasons why claims can be made.
